Description
The assistant coach will work with the head coach and activities director to ensure the highest possible level of service is delivered to students while fostering a culture of academic excellence. Further, in conjunction with the head coach, the assistant coach will help each participating student achieve a high level of skill, an appreciation for the values of discipline and sportsmanship, and an increased level of self-esteem.
Essential Functions:
- Coach individual participants in the skills necessary for excellent achievement in the sport involved.
- Plans and schedules a regular program of practice in season.
- Works closely with the head coach to enforce discipline and sportsmanlike behavior at all times, and to establish and oversee penalties for breach of such standards by individual students.
- Demonstrates effective human relations and communication skills.
- Assists the head coach with the organization and supervision of the sports program.
- Complies with good safety practices.
- Complies with all district rules, regulations and policies.
- Other duties/responsibilities deemed necessary as may be assigned.
Skills/Qualifications:
- Valid Missouri teacher certificate.
- Employment as a teacher in the Jefferson City School District.
- Previous coaching experience in assigned sport, preferred.
- Such alternatives to the above qualifications as the board may deem appropriate.
